Output e87fd61fa0335a0d737ae1afc8b5f0c618f83fc2ee29dd92e63b3d5bba2b12fb:1

value
10605
script pubkey
OP_0 OP_PUSHBYTES_20 12921629a2ab8ed24089e5cea98cabdc1785de85
address
bc1qz2fpv2dz4w8dysyfuh82nr9tmstcth59tfv0uh
transaction
e87fd61fa0335a0d737ae1afc8b5f0c618f83fc2ee29dd92e63b3d5bba2b12fb
confirmations
26570
spent
true